Honor children’s unique strengths, needs, and interests through intentional instruction.

No two children are the same, so why should their instruction be? Intentional instruction recognizes and addresses children’s individuality and unlocks new opportunities to help every child learn, grow, and thrive.

But intentional instruction doesn’t happen by chance.
Intentionality is a result of reflection, preparation, and flexibility. It is built upon a foundation of trusting relationships, established goals, and information about children’s development in general and each child as an individual. Moreover, it requires motivation, inspiration, and tools.
